Charles Hoskinson, creator of Cardano, addressed tensions with the XRP community in a recent video shared by Digital Asset Investor (@digitalassetbuy). He reflected on accusations from the XRP community that he did not support them during the SEC lawsuit.

Hoskinson clarified, “I did support you when you got sued by the Security Exchange Commission. There’s videos of me. You could pull them up from years ago, where I said it was the wrong decision.”

While he had issues with the XRP army at the time, he still realized that the SEC’s actions were wrong. Despite this, some in the XRP community questioned why he did not provide financial aid.

Ripple’s Financial Independence

Hoskinson emphasized that Ripple had significant resources to manage the SEC case independently. “The Ripple organization gave itself a mammoth pre-mine. That’s a fact. It’s like tens of billions of dollars now that they have access to. They didn’t need any money,” he said.

He compared Ripple to other projects such as EOS, which allocated $4 billion to itself in 2017. Hoskinson highlighted that Cardano, by contrast, did not allocate 70% of its supply to founders.

Funding and Revenue

Hoskinson questioned the origins of Ripple’s funding for major initiatives. He asked where Ripple secured the funding to acquire Hidden Road for $1.25 billion. He also drew attention to the revenue from RLUSD, the stablecoin the company launched in late 2024.

He pointed out that standard subscription models alone could not generate the scale of these projects. His remarks show that Ripple kept XRP to fund its operations rather than giving the tokens out to the public.

Hoskinson’s Selective Focus

Digital Asset Investor noted that while Hoskinson critiqued the XRP community, he did not address Ethereum’s ICO and its funding model. He is publicly criticizing Ripple’s actions, but just like the SEC did, he has not called out Ethereum, which did a similar thing through its ICO.

This omission is crucial because Ethereum also had substantial pre-mined allocations. This raised questions about the balance of Hoskinson’s critique, even as he acknowledged past engagement with Ripple executives and expressed willingness to collaborate with the company.

The Challenge in Crypto Discourse

Hoskinson addressed challenges in crypto discussions, noting that many people struggle to separate arguments from personalities. He criticized the effects of social media, cable news, and poor information habits, emphasizing that these factors make nuanced conversation and critical thinking difficult in the industry.

However, as Digital Asset Investor highlighted, Hoskinson criticized the XRP community while failing to mention Ethereum’s ICO. This selective focus raises questions about consistency in his critique.

An announcement was made by CME Group, the largest derivatives exchanger worldwide, revealed that it would introduce options for Solana and XRP futures. It is the latest addition to CME crypto derivatives as institutions and retail investors increase their demand for Solana and XRP. CME Expands Crypto Offerings With Solana and XRP Options Launch According to a press release, the launch is scheduled for October 13, 2025, pending regulatory approval. The new products will allow traders to access options on Solana, Micro Solana, XRP, and Micro XRP futures. Expiries will be offered on business days on a monthly, and quarterly basis to provide more flexibility to market players. CME Group said the contracts are designed to meet demand from institutions, hedge funds, and active retail traders. According to Giovanni Vicioso, the launch reflects high liquidity in Solana and XRP futures. Vicioso is the Global Head of Cryptocurrency Products for the CME Group. He noted that the new contracts will provide additional tools for risk management and exposure strategies. Recently, CME XRP futures registered record open interest amid ETF approval optimism, reinforcing confidence in contract demand. Cumberland, one of the leading liquidity providers, welcomed the development and said it highlights the shift beyond Bitcoin and Ethereum. FalconX, another trading firm, added that rising digital asset treasuries are increasing the need for hedging tools on alternative tokens like Solana and XRP. High Record Trading Volumes Demand Solana and XRP Futures Solana futures and XRP continue to gain popularity since their launch earlier this year. According to CME official records, many have bought and sold more than 540,000 Solana futures contracts since March. A value that amounts to over $22 billion dollars. Solana contracts hit a record 9,000 contracts in August, worth $437 million. Open interest also set a record at 12,500 contracts.…
